Transaction ae4d8d2310a279aea4867866740eeccc3cd675b48ef2a4a7564820daca9e2876

block
a2fe7d3c07a0307d86c11db2eb7b6f7c7c29f7f59d8ad5d135107077d945a756

2 Inputs

989 Outputs